Meeting notes — payments sync, Thursday

Quick recap for the new folks: retries on the Ledgerline checkout flow were double-charging when the network flaked. Fix is idempotency keys — client generates one per payment attempt, server stores it for 24h and replays the original response on duplicates. Key format and TTL are settled; storage backend still under discussion. Drop questions about the design to the person who owns it.

account owner for bawip-tahag: Raleth Quenok

Leadership Review Briefing — Finance Team

The combined property and cyber policy with Dorrel & Veare lapses at quarter end. Renewal quotes show a 12% increase, driven by sector-wide cyber repricing rather than our claims history. An alternative quote from Castelow Assurance is 7% cheaper but excludes flood cover at the Meriden site. A recommendation follows, with strategic context provided confidentially below.

confidential, yahip-hagug: Gorixax Logistics plans to lower the Ulaael list price by 26.6 percent in October. The pricing group signed off on a budget of $199.9 million for Project Holix. The renewal with Kasdorox Systems closes at $137.5 million a year, 8.2 percent above the last contract. Project Lamion slips by a full year because of the audit delay.

## Deployment: Contrast Audit Service

The Huecheck audit service scans each deployed page for color-contrast failures and posts results to the Tideboard dashboard before the weekly sync. It runs as a post-deploy hook and blocks promotion on any AA-level failure. The hook inherits its settings from the deploy environment, and the active values are shown below.

deployment values, kahof-yadug:
[gorys]
team = silael
access_code = ac_00d620
owner = istox.oliys
host = gorys.torvastack.example
port = 9000
peer = holmir.merlaqsoft.example
salt = 9fdae78a
pin = 2358

## Onboarding — Markdown Pipeline (Inkmere)

Inkmere docs render through a three-stage pipeline: parse, sanitize, emit. Releases rebuild all templates; never hot-patch emitted HTML. Broken renders usually mean a sanitizer rule change — check the rules diff first. The render cluster only accepts builds from the release channel, and every build artifact must be signed before upload. Sign artifacts with the deploy key below.

release key, hafop-tajef: bky13_s2vaFVNJTHfBL